Entry today-Google translation:

Action station: Today we a young eagle owl with a GPS transmitter. The channel is carried out in collaboration with OWN, Forestry, SOVON, and Birds. It is made possible by financial support from Prince Bernhard Cultural Fund, the Province of Limburg, BirdLife and donations for the project in spring 2009 Experience. The action is expected between 10.30 - 13.30 hours place. Possibly the camera during the capture operations are temporarily disabled, there is nothing wrong with your computer. If the young owl back then still on the screen, you will see the antenna and possibly a portion of the transmitter to see. If the eagle owl is fully grown, the sender will no longer be seen and only the ante net. Every 10 days we will publish www.oehoe.web-log.nl what the young eagle owl has been up. Until September / October will provide data on how the young owl discovers the surrounding terrain. But then of course really valuable. Where will the eagle owl over and above ...... in what kind of areas, he / she breaks a few days or longer. We want to map such areas because it is clearly important for the species. Every evening at 23:00 hours, the owl using GPS technology located, hopefully about a year.
